THROUGH POSITIVE EYES

Date: From June 1, 2017 to February 28, 2018

Location: Iziko Slave Lodge. South Africa

Through Positive Eyes is an exhibition which builds on the work of South African photographer Gideon Mendel, who used the power of the arts to eradicate HIV stigma.

Award-winning photographer Gideon Mendel and UCLA professor David Gere have, for the last 10 years, been building Through Positive Eyes, a participatory photography project in which people living with HIV and AIDS (PLWHA) share their stories in the form of photos, video, and narrative. Through Positive Eyes features over 100 photographs, an array of commissioned two-dimensional and sculptural works, and live storytelling documenting the realities of individuals.
